Maths

Top set year 8 students recently took part in the Junior maths challenge and achieved some excellent results.

Congratulations to Toby Evans, Matthew Turner, Megan Price and Sam Gorf who all achieved Gold awards.

In addition, there were 11 Silver and 21 Bronze awarded.

Technology Tournament

On the 12th March 2009 I took twelve pupils to Denbigh School to take part in a Rotary Technology Tournament.  This is an event that takes place once a year and is organised by different Rotary clubs from around Milton Keynes.  The event is held at different schools each year, and it is a chance for every secondary school in Milton Keynes to take part and compete against each other.  They split the judging into three different categories:

The task changes each year; this year the teams had to design, make and test a catapult system. Depending on the level they are entered, there are different tasks they are expected to undertake. For example, the Basic team had to produce the catapult system, while the Intermediate and Advanced teams also had to include a parachute, and then the Advanced teams also had to have a carrier for their catapult.
At the Basic and Intermediate levels there were around fifteen teams.  There were only four Advanced teams.
I was very proud of all the pupils I took with me, they all worked very hard and produced work that was exceptional.
12032009186.jpg

 

So… I hear you say, what were the results… Well, the Advanced team came a very close 2nd, the Intermediate team came 5th and this was due to an error in their final testing, as up until that point they were top of the leader board.  The ultimate stars though were the Basic team who came 1st (they won it hands down I might add!)
An enjoyable time by all and I will definitely be taking three teams next year, this time I want to bring back two trophies!
